support/libtool: improve version 1.5 static patching
Alter the libtool 1.5.x support patch to accomodate for wildly different versions of ltmain.sh Just make it alter incoming args from -static to -all-static which seems to apply to all the different variants out there since argument parsing is unlikely to change much.
